Output 6faf53726a2cd405705b93a891e04821a96f2d4cd735719003bea4b3823edcc6:17

value
1842066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c77b7e2642f1da37039b8170b279b6d08e3bad9b OP_EQUAL
address
3KsnL9S1tzBpvUzt9TPPdAfjDP2ZFRSXzb
transaction
6faf53726a2cd405705b93a891e04821a96f2d4cd735719003bea4b3823edcc6